Another significant benefit of fiberglass geogrid with PVC coating is its ability to reduce reflective cracking. Reflective cracking occurs when cracks in the underlying pavement propagate through the overlay, leading to premature failure of the asphalt surface. By incorporating fiberglass geogrid with PVC coating into the pavement structure, the tensile stresses caused by traffic loading are effectively distributed, minimizing the occurrence of reflective cracking.

To install fiberglass geogrid with PVC coating, the subgrade should be properly prepared. This involves removing any vegetation, loose soil, and debris. The subgrade should then be compacted to provide a stable base for the geogrid. Once the subgrade is ready, the geogrid is rolled out and secured in place using stakes or adhesive. The geogrid should be overlapped at the edges to ensure a continuous reinforcement layer.
